Metrolina Greenhouses Schedules Summer Trials

Metrolina Greenhouses has scheduled its annual Trial Gardens Open House for members of the floriculture industry from 7 a.m. to 2 p.m. on Thursday, June 9.

The annual event is part of the Southern Garden Tour, which includes stops at Young’s Plant Farm in Auburn, Alabama, on June 7 and the University of Georgia in Athens, Georgia, on June 8, according to a news release.

Metrolina Greenhouses will also open the Trial Gardens to gardening consumers for its Home Garden Panel consumer research event on Friday, June 10, according to the news release. Metrolina’s Home Garden Panel conducts annual consumer gardening research that informs Metrolina and its partners about gardening consumers’ purchasing habits, decision drivers and item preferences.This event will only be open to advocate-level industry members of Metrolina Greenhouses’ Home Garden Panel to interact with gardening consumers in research discussions and focus groups.

This year’s Trial Gardens open house marks roughly 20 years since the operation began hosting its annual summer trials.

The Trial Gardens will evaluate more than 2,000 items:

  • 1,956 annuals.
  • 418 perennials.
  • 375 second-year perennials.
  • 203 2-gallon combination hanging baskets.
  • 126 planters.

Additionally, Metrolina Greenhouses’ research and development team has chosen heuchera to evaluate this year for its perennial genus trial.
